首页游戏攻略文章正文

SVG动画:提升网页交互体验的秘密武器

游戏攻略2024年12月04日 14:33:2315admin

SVG动画:提升网页交互体验的秘密武器在当今的网页设计中,SVG(可缩放矢量图形)动画已经成为了一种流行的趋势。它不仅能够提供高质量的图形表现,还能实现丰富的交互效果,为用户带来更为生动和沉浸的浏览体验。我们这篇文章将探讨SVG动画在网页

svg动画生成

SVG动画:提升网页交互体验的秘密武器

在当今的网页设计中,SVG(可缩放矢量图形)动画已经成为了一种流行的趋势。它不仅能够提供高质量的图形表现,还能实现丰富的交互效果,为用户带来更为生动和沉浸的浏览体验。我们这篇文章将探讨SVG动画在网页设计中的应用,分析其优势、实现方法以及如何优化SEO以提高搜索引擎排名。我们这篇文章内容包括但不限于:SVG动画的优势SVG动画的实现方法SVG动画与SEO优化SVG动画的最佳实践案例分析常见问题解答


一、SVG动画的优势

SVG动画具有多种优势,使其成为网页设计师的首选。在一开始,SVG是基于矢量的,这意味着它可以无限放大而不失真,非常适合高分辨率屏幕。然后接下来,SVG动画体积小,加载速度快,对网站性能影响较小。此外,SVG支持交互性,用户可以通过鼠标点击或悬停来控制动画,从而增强用户体验。

SVG动画还可以与CSS和JavaScript结合,实现更复杂的动画效果。这些特点使得SVG动画在网页设计中具有广泛的应用前景。


二、SVG动画的实现方法

实现SVG动画有多种方法,包括使用SVG的内置动画元素(如<animate><animateTransform>),以及通过CSS和JavaScript来控制动画。使用SVG内置元素简单直观,但功能有限;而CSS和JavaScript则提供了更高的灵活性和控制力。

此外,还有各种第三方库和工具,如GreenSock Animation Platform(GSAP),可以简化SVG动画的创建和调试过程。


三、SVG动画与SEO优化

虽然SVG动画本身对SEO没有直接的影响,但正确的实现和优化策略可以提升网页的搜索引擎排名。例如,确保动画加载快速,不影响页面内容的可见性;使用语义化的标签和描述性的文件名;以及合理利用SVG的titledesc元素来提供额外的上下文信息。

此外,避免使用纯JavaScript实现的动画,因为这可能会被搜索引擎蜘蛛忽略,从而影响页面内容的索引。


四、SVG动画的最佳实践

为了确保SVG动画在网页中的最佳表现,以下是一些最佳实践:保持动画简洁,避免过度使用;确保动画对用户体验有实际贡献;优化动画性能,避免长时间加载;以及考虑无障碍性,确保动画对所有用户友好。

在实现动画时,还应注意代码的可维护性和可读性,使用注释和模块化代码,便于未来的修改和扩展。


五、案例分析

我们这篇文章将通过几个案例分析SVG动画在网页设计中的应用,包括动画如何增强品牌形象、提高用户参与度以及提升页面转化率。这些案例将展示SVG动画在现代网页设计中的实际价值和潜力。


六、常见问题解答

为什么使用SVG动画而不是传统的GIF或Flash动画?

SVG动画提供更好的图像质量和交互性,体积更小,加载更快,并且兼容现代网页标准。与GIF和Flash相比,SVG动画更适合响应式设计,能够在各种设备和屏幕尺寸上保持一致性。

SVG动画对网站性能有影响吗?

SVG动画本身对性能的影响较小,但过度的动画或不当的实现方式可能会影响页面加载时间和用户体验。通过优化动画和合理使用资源,可以最小化对性能的影响。

如何确保SVG动画在不同浏览器上的兼容性?

确保SVG动画在不同浏览器上的兼容性,需要测试多种浏览器和设备,并使用适当的回退机制。例如,可以使用polyfills来支持旧版浏览器中的SVG特性。

SVG动画是否需要专业知识才能创建?

虽然SVG动画可能需要一定的编程知识,但现代的工具和库极大地简化了创建过程。即使是非专业人员,也可以通过学习和使用这些工具来创建出色的SVG动画。

标签: SVG动画网页设计SEO优化

游戏爱好者之家-连接玩家,共享激情Copyright @ 2013-2023 All Rights Reserved. 版权所有备案号:京ICP备2024049502号-11